How much does a Leon's Full Service Lead Cook make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Lead Cook at Leon's Full Service is $35,227, which translates to approximately $17 per hour. Salaries for Lead Cook at Leon's Full Service typically range from $32,465 to $39,987,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. Key determinants include years of experience, specific skill sets, educational background, and relevant certifications. **Job Description** The Lead Cook is responsible for cooking and preparing food using standard recipes and production guidelines while following food safety, food handling, and sanitation procedures. The individual in this role should safely handle knives and equipment including grills, fryers, ovens, broilers, etc. The Lead Cook may supervise employees and delegate responsibilities. The responsibilities of the position may vary by location based on client requirements and business needs. **Job Responsibilities** ? Schedules and assigns daily work activities to staff and supervises the completion of tasks. ? Trains and guides staff on job duties, standard food safety and sanitation procedures, cooking methods, etc. ? Cooks and prepares food following production guidelines and standardized recipes ?
